Exploring Essential AI Tools for Professionals
AI for Productivity
1. Trello with Butler
Trello, a popular project management tool, integrates AI through its ‘Butler’ feature. Butler automates repetitive tasks such as moving cards and creating checklists based on user-defined rules.
2. Notion AI
Notion offers an all-in-one workspace that includes AI tools for note-taking, organization, and task management. Its AI capabilities can help in generating content and summarizing lengthy documents, enhancing overall productivity.
AI for Project Management
1. Asana
Asana uses AI to streamline project tracking and reporting. The tool offers predictive features that anticipate roadblocks based on project progress, allowing teams to adjust their strategies proactively.
2. Monday.com
Monday.com leverages AI to analyze project workflows and suggest optimizations. Its visual dashboard helps teams stay aligned and efficient, ultimately improving project outcomes.
AI for Data Analysis
1. Tableau
Tableau is renowned for its data visualization capabilities, but it also employs AI for predictive analysis. This feature enables professionals to forecast trends, making data-driven decisions more effective.
2. Google Analytics
Integrating AI with web analytics, Google Analytics provides insights on user behavior and traffic patterns. This helps businesses understand customer journeys, enhancing their marketing strategies.
AI for Customer Service
1. Chatbots (e.g., Drift, Intercom)
AI-powered chatbots can engage users in real-time, answering inquiries and resolving issues. By handling customer interactions autonomously, they free customer service teams to focus on more complex tasks.
2. Zendesk AI
Zendesk’s AI features enhance customer support by analyzing tickets and recommending solutions. This capability reduces response time and increases customer satisfaction.
AI for Marketing and Content Creation
1. HubSpot
HubSpot uses AI to personalize marketing emails and optimize content strategy based on audience behavior. The platform tailors marketing efforts for improved engagement and conversion rates.
2. Copy.ai
Copy.ai leverages AI to help professionals generate marketing copy and content. This tool streamlines content creation, allowing users to produce copy in a fraction of the time.
Implementing AI Tools in Your Workflow
Assessing Your Needs
Before adopting AI tools, it is essential to evaluate your organization’s requirements. Identify repetitive tasks that can be automated and areas where data analysis is critical for making informed decisions.
Training and Integration
Proper training is vital to ensuring successful implementation. Engage team members in learning how to effectively utilize AI tools to maximize their benefits. Integration with existing systems should also be seamless to avoid disruption.
Monitoring and Feedback
Once implemented, continually monitor the performance of AI tools. Collect feedback from team members to identify areas for improvement or adjustment in use.
Challenges and Considerations
Data Privacy
The use of AI tools often involves processing sensitive data, which raises concerns regarding privacy. Ensure compliance with data protection regulations when deploying AI technologies.
Over-reliance on Technology
While AI can enhance efficiency, relying too heavily on it may diminish critical thinking and problem-solving skills among professionals. It’s important to strike a balance between automation and human intuition.
Cost of Implementation
Although AI tools can save costs in the long term, the initial investment can be substantial. Organizations must assess their budget and plan for potential future expenses associated with AI adoption.
